An old colleague who was at the Brive vs Stade Francais Challenge Cup game mentioned that Pablo Matera is rumoured to be struggling to settle in Paris. Stade Francais is hardly a happy camp currently sitting bottom of the Top 14 and having a coaching overhaul at the start of the season so I could see something in that given Matera came from captaining the Jaguares to 2nd in Super Rugby. I believe he has a back niggle at the moment too which naturally won't be helping matters at all.
